The City in the rear: how Kolomyia lives now

Kolomyia has shown a significant increase in the Transparency Ranking over the 5 years of our studies. It was ranked 17th out of 100 cities: from 18.3 points in 2017 to 66.8 in 2021. 

However, Kolomyia can boast not only about this improvement. The city withstands difficulties with dignity and remains a reliable rear and shelter in the bitter time of war.

Kolomyia has hosted about 9,000 IDPs as of August (with a total of 70,000 inhabitants living in the hromada).

  • Kolomyia hromada has received a lot of aid, for example, from Canada and Switzerland and from the sister city of Sighet, Romania since the beginning of the full-scale invasion.
  • The mobile brigade was organized in Kolomyia to advise the displaced and help solve their problems. It includes representatives of Ivano-Frankivsk Regional State Administration, the Regional Center for Free Legal Aid in the region, a psychologist, and social security workers.
  • Kolomyia hromada continues to assist Ukrainian defenders in various ways. A charity football tournament was organized in the city, thanks to which it was possible to collect funds for the needs of defenders of Ukraine: https://bit.ly/3QWS0xI
  • Ukrainian language courses were organized in the city for IDPs who want to improve or learn Ukrainian. The courses were held in cooperation with the winner of the Global Teacher Prize Ukraine 2021 Artur Proidakov.
  • The volunteer initiative “Vulyk Zmistiv” (Content Hive) provides a hostel for IDPs here: https://bit.ly/3AGFJbs.

“We plan to arrange not just a shelter, we would like to build a Home. Social cohesion is at the heart of the concept. This place will be an impetus for IDPs to become part of the urban hromada.”
